​Basil Hummus (Or Rosemary)

Prep time: 15 minutes
Cook time: 5 minutes
 
Ingredients
  • 1/4 cup pine nuts
  • 2 cups sweet basil leaves, packed
  • 3 cloves garlic, smashed then minced
  • 2 15-ounce cans garbanzo beans (chickpeas), rinsed and drained*   Can also use cannelloni beans as well! 
  • 1/4 cup olive oil
  • Up to 1/4 cup water
  • 1/3 cup fresh lemon juice
  • 1 1/2 to 2 teaspoons salt
  • Dash of black pepper
  • One drop of Basil essential oil, and one drop lemon essential oil, if desired for more flavor
 
For Rosemary hummus, omit the pine nuts and basil and add 1-2 Tablespoons minced fresh Rosemary, 1-2 drops rosemary essential oil, 1-2 drops lemon essential oil
 
Put all together in blend or food processor and adjust ingredients as needed to get consistency you like!
Enjoy!
